# Break-Glass: Catalog Cache Invalidation

Scope: the Pinrow product catalog at Veldstone Retail. If stale prices persist after a purge and the Hollowmere invalidation queue is wedged, use break-glass to flush the edge tier directly. Contractors: get verbal sign-off from the catalog lead first. Steps: open the Hollowmere admin shell, select emergency-flush, confirm the tenant, and run it once — repeated flushes thrash the origin. Access is logged and expires after 20 minutes. Unseal the admin shell with the passphrase below.

recovery phrase for kahop-tajog: istix-casvan

# MockSmith env file — please read before approving
# This file configures the MockSmith test-data factory for CI runs.
# Reviewers: confirm that no production connection strings appear here;
# MockSmith must only ever talk to the disposable fixtures database.
# The deterministic seed lives in config, not here. The one sensitive
# value in this file is the factory's signing secret, which must be
# set on the line immediately after this sentence.

vault entry, kafog-yahop: COURIER_KEY8=0faa53ae

## Deployment

Plugin authors extending the Tallygrove loyalty-points ledger must deploy against a staging tenant first. The ledger enforces idempotent point mutations, so ensure your plugin declares its mutation scope accurately before promotion. After installation, the ledger validates your plugin against its runtime settings. Please review the following configuration values carefully before submitting for certification:

settings of kagup-tagug:
ULAIX_HOST=ulaix.zemvarsys.internal
ULAIX_PORT=8000

Ticket: Intermittent connection failures from the Brindlewick schema registry during event validation. The registry pod drops its pool roughly every 40 minutes, causing producers on the Quillfeather bus to retry and stall releases. We've ruled out DNS and TLS expiry; it appears tied to the registry's metadata store. For verification before the 4.2 cut, the affected store is reachable via the connection string below.

replica DSN, kajep-yahag: mssql://praok_svc:iF@db-8d68.plorvaio.local:5432/eliion